The correct answer is - chlorophyll, thylakoid, grana, chloroplast.
Explanation:
The light-dependent reaction of the photosynthesis process takes place in the thylakoid membranes present in the organelle called the chloroplast. This membrane is the part of the grana, a stack of the thylakoids.
Thylakoid is bounded with the pigment called chlorophyll that traps the light in order to start this reaction. So the series of structural components from the smallest to the largest of the light-dependent reaction is chlorophyll, thylakoid, grana, chloroplast.
